Where did Andrew Tate come from?

Who Is Andrew Tate? Is Andrew Tate Really A Trillionaire?

Tate, who began his career as a kickboxer, made his debut in the public eye during the 2016 season of the UK's Big Brother reality show. It was six days long. After a video surfaced showing him threatening violence against a woman if she text him again, Tate was fired from the show.

He told The Sun that the duo was playing roles. He shared a selfie with the woman in the video, smiling, and stated that they were still friends.

Tate launched an internet webcamming business after retiring from kickboxing, claiming that up to 75 women, including some ex-girlfriends, worked for him. In an interview with the British newspaper Mirror earlier this year, Tate referred to the webcam industry as a "complete fraud" in which women fabricated "sob stories" to convince men to part with their money.

Tate has recently gained notoriety as an internet personality who promises to teach boys and men how to "leave the matrix" - an abbreviation for becoming richer and more successful with women. Before being banned from social media networks, he had more than 4.5 million Instagram followers and 600,000 YouTube subscribers for his "Tate Speech" channel.

TikTok videos including his hashtag have received over 14 billion views. Tate's majority of material does not deal with women. Tate also spoke out against COVID lockdowns and vaccine requirements, despite copious evidence that COVID-19 vaccines are effective in preventing hospitalizations and deaths. What is Hustler's University?

Cousineau stated that while Andrew Tate's talking points are not novel, what sets Tate apart is that "he worked out a unique technique to game the contemporary social media scene."
Tate learned how to create money online through Hustler's University, his self-help online course. It pays £39 ($45) every month to gain access to 12 "multimillionaire gurus in their chosen sector," according to the website.

The training covers copywriting, e-commerce, cryptocurrency, stocks, and freelancing.

The Guardian reports that a portion of Tate's social media presence is attributable to Hustler's University's "affiliate marketing" operation. The magazine states that Hustler's University members receive a 48% commission for each referral, and Hustler's University actively pushes its students to share incendiary Tate content on TikTok and other social media platforms.

Polarizing movies receive more views, and more views mean more recommendations for "students" at Hustler's University.

"There are those who say, 'Don't give him publicity; let him fade away,'" said Roose of Deakin University. "However, this has an effect on our young guys. Whereas older males are normally more prone to be mistrustful of minority groups, a

surprisingly high proportion of younger men, a sizeable minority, are opposed to women having equal rights to men."

These individuals are taking advantage of that demography.

The decision to restrict Tate's access to social media has been challenged by some. This includes social media personality-turned-professional boxer Jake Paul, who, despite condemning Tate's blatant misogyny, criticised what he termed social media censorship.

Cousineau and Roose both argue that the prohibition is justified.

"There is no question that banning Tate from mainstream platforms causes radicalization in niche social media and online spaces," Cousineau said. "However, Andrew Tate and others like him will not be exposed to millions of new people and receive

billions of views in these niche spaces, thereby minimizing the cultural impact of their rhetoric."
